Autoclave Biological Dyes: Verifying Freedom from Germs

To confirm the efficacy of sterilization chamber cycles, biological tests are vital. These small devices contain highly sensitive bacterial spores that will just survive if the process was faulty. A lack result – meaning the spores were eradicated – gives dependable evidence of sterility. Conversely, a positive result suggests a problem with the sterilization process that requires urgent correction.

A Part of Biological Tests in Sterilization Validation

Living checks play a essential function in disinfection verification processes. These checks, typically spores strains, are deliberately added into the disinfection load to determine the procedure's success. A successful outcome – demonstrating total inactivation of the biological entity – confirms the disinfection process is capable of attaining the necessary standard of cleanliness . Lack of inactivation signals a fault requiring analysis and preventative action .
